  • Eric Guido Likes this wine: 89 points

    July 16, 2018 - First and foremost, you're missing out if not giving this a taste at cellar temp. The 2016 Roagna Dolcetto comes across as exactly what I would want and expect from a traditional Dolcetto, with a bouquet of crushed blackberries, wild herbs, violets, dried orange peel and hints of black earth and stone dust. On the palate, I found light, feminine textures with bright acids playing host to a mix of zesty black fruits and minerals. The finish was medium-long, as brisk acids pinched at the senses, leaving hints of tart blackberry and purple inner florals.

    It's a great wine for warm weather sipping at cellar temp, but also fantastic with food.
